13.07.2015 Views

BCV5 - Enterprise Systems Associates, Inc.

BCV5 - Enterprise Systems Associates, Inc.

BCV5 - Enterprise Systems Associates, Inc.

SHOW MORE
SHOW LESS
  • No tags were found...

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

<strong>BCV5</strong> TMFAST AND EFFICIENTDB2 DATA MIGRATIONSCorporations maintain large amounts of data in DB2 databases, and it is normal to fi nd several DB2subsystems for production, test and development. Refreshing testbeds from production systems isa vital part of the development, testing and quality assurance life cycle. Obtaining relevant test datarequires copying from one DB2 subsystem to another. The window of opportunity for copying ormigrating DB2 data is constantly decreasing as the demands from 24x7 operations are increasing.Limited resources and shrinking batch windows make data delivery to QA diffi cult.CV5 quickly and effi ciently copies, refreshes andB replicates DB2 objects. <strong>BCV5</strong> copies DB2 databasesor tables within the same or different DB2 systems. Whenmeasured against conventional copying methods, <strong>BCV5</strong>saves around 90% on elapsed copy time and resourcesconsumed (SSU, SRU). For one customer a ten-hourunload/load process was reduced to slightly over one hour.A <strong>BCV5</strong> copy task integrates both the physical datamovement and the DDL related requirements. It copiesDB2 data, i.e. databases or tables with or without auxiliaryobjects – indexes, views, triggers, procs and runstats.<strong>BCV5</strong> automatically handles the OBID translation and theRBA adaptation. Copy jobs are completed in minutesrather than hours. DBAs are no longer forced to wait forweekend time slots and are able to run copying jobs onregular weekday shifts. Test data on demand is a dreamcome true for QA, development and test staff. <strong>BCV5</strong>offers relief where the need is greatest. It signifi cantly cutsdown runtime and cost. It reduces CPU consumption by90%+ and shortens the preparation lead time requiredby the staff.Automation Reduces Manual Effort and Keystroke Errors<strong>BCV5</strong> is a completely automated expert system. Theintegrated ISPF interface allows the copy process to beeasily defi ned. Specifying the select/exclude patternsidentifi es the objects to be copied and the appropriateprocessing options. <strong>BCV5</strong>’s powerful renames maskfacility makes adhering to naming conventions during thetarget DB2 system a simple and error free task. A <strong>BCV5</strong>copy process executes either under the control of theproduct or an in-house scheduler. Once the copy processis started there is nothing else to do. <strong>BCV5</strong> automaticallygenerates the DDL for the selected objects/databases using the specifi ed target names. It executesthe DDL in the target DB2 environment, tailors the respectiveJCL and generates the required statements forthe copy utility. What if the target objects already exist?<strong>BCV5</strong> still automates everything. It is an expert systemwith a comprehensive check facility that ensures that thetarget DB2 objects match the source objects. Structuraldifferences are detected and successful completion of thecopy process is guaranteed.Flexible Selection of Image Copies<strong>BCV5</strong> permits copying directly from tablespacesor a set of image copies. Its fl exibleselection facility allows choosing theimage copy (set) to copy from. Using thelatest, a specifi c generation or dated imagecopy is easy and straight forward. Itidentifi es the right image copy datasetsand pulls them into the copy process.1 | 5 © UBS Hainer distributed in the US and Canada by ESAi - <strong>Enterprise</strong> <strong>Systems</strong> <strong>Associates</strong>, <strong>Inc</strong>.Contact ESAI Contact at: 1-866-464-3724 ESAi at 1-866-GO-4-ESAi or sales@ESAIGroup.comor


<strong>BCV5</strong> – FAST AND EFFICIENT DB2 DATA MIGRATIONSBenefits• Automates DB2 Cloning/Migrating/Refreshing• Saves 90% CPU resources and run time• Eliminates manual efforts freeing up technical staff• Reduces overtime work and manual intervention• Integrates seamlessly into IT environments• Eliminates RUNSTATS, Rebuild Index, etc.• Reduces DASD space required for direct copyingRUNSTATS Cost Time and MoneyDB2‘s optimizer needs valid RUNSTATS data to fi ndeffi cient access paths. The RUNSTATS utility is known asa long running CPU hog. <strong>BCV5</strong> eliminates costly RUN-STATS executions. Its copy statistics feature extracts thecurrent RUNSTATS from the source environment and loadsthem into the target in seconds. It is no longer necessaryto wait for hours while RUNSTATS fi nishes running.Why is <strong>BCV5</strong> so fast?<strong>BCV5</strong> copies the data at the page level using a proprietaryhigh performance copy utilty. While the UNLOAD/LOADprocess slowly extracts single rows one at a time, <strong>BCV5</strong>copies the complete page over to thetarget and replaces the DB2-internalOBIDs with the respective target values.<strong>BCV5</strong> also uses parallelism as a performanceenhancement technique. Itoperates in a multi-thread mode andcopies ten to eighteen tablespaces ortablespace partitions in parallel. Thisalone makes it up to ten times fasterthan DSN1COPY. One other performanceenhancement feature involvescopying indexspaces. Copying indexspacesis much faster than rebuildingthem.How can <strong>BCV5</strong> save 90% CPU Time?Row-wise processing consumes many more CPU cyclesthan VSAM copying. Clients report that only one-fi fth toone-tenth of the service units used by Unload/Load arerequired to run <strong>BCV5</strong>. Add to these savings those resultingfrom avoiding index rebuilds and runstats executions.LOADs demand heavy DB2 subsystem resources. Theload job’s CPU consumption is reported in the job listing,but the very high service units used by DB2 is no normallytallied. The immense amount of data, that corporationsneed to maintain, demands the use of effi cient tools. It isnot longer feasible to waste time and service units needlessly.There is an added bonus for users with really largetables. <strong>BCV5</strong> does not require storage for unloaded data.BVC5 copies data directly from the source pageset to thetarget pageset.Making the Copy Process EasyA fast and effi cient cloning tool is only part of the solution.The <strong>BCV5</strong> user interface is intuitive and easily meetsthe needs of both experienced effi ciency-minded expertsand the less technical application level users. Those whoprefer the PC environment can use <strong>BCV5</strong>’s graphical workstation.Detailed online help is always one click away.Who needs <strong>BCV5</strong>?Cost savings are obviously appreciated by those whohave budget responsibility. Avoiding an expensive andonerous hardware upgrade can reduce the negativeimpact to an IT budget. The IBM andthird party software upgrade fees associatedwith getting a bigger machineoften dwarf the hardware cost. Applicationdevelopment teams, QA groups,technical support staff, auditors and,of course, end users need the data toget their jobs done. <strong>BCV5</strong> reduces the2 | 5 © UBS Hainer distributed in the US and Canada by ESAi - <strong>Enterprise</strong> <strong>Systems</strong> <strong>Associates</strong>, <strong>Inc</strong>.Contact ESAI Contact at: 1-866-464-3724 ESAi at 1-866-GO-4-ESAi or sales@ESAIGroup.comor


<strong>BCV5</strong> – FAST AND EFFICIENT DB2 DATA MIGRATIONS» <strong>BCV5</strong> allows us to copy much moredata than we ever could have copiedwith our old LOAD based processes.This is great improvement for ourQA environments. «Features• Checks and/or generates DDL• Automates tasks for: OBID, RBA, LRSN, Grants, etc.• Flexible space allocation• Offers intuitive ISPF interface for easy management• Provides a batch interface to create large numbersof copies• Offers optional components for data reduction,data masking, and DDL structure analysisamount of weekend and off-shift time usually requiredfor the copy and refresh process. This allows more qualitywork to get completed during regular shift hours. Shopsrunning with reduced or less experienced staff are among<strong>BCV5</strong>’s most vocal supporters. Getting the job done is,after all, the true mission of IT. When data is not available,the job does not get accomplished and the wholeorganization pays the price.A Quick View of <strong>BCV5</strong><strong>BCV5</strong> provides fast, effi cient and manageable copying ofDB2 data. It automatically generates and executes jobsto: • extract object defi nitions from the DB2 catalog ofthe source system, • transfer the defi nitions to the targetsystem, rename the objects as specifi ed and apply themin the target DB2 system (CREATE, or DROP and CREATE),• compare the source defi nitions with existing targetobjects for compatibility, • copy pagesets from source totarget DB2, • make target objects ready and start them.The product provides two user interfaces with identicalfunctions. One is based on ISPF and the other on a workstationGUI.To defi ne a copy task, select andd efi n e : • the DB2 subsystems, sourceand target which are identical if copyingwithin a single subsystem, • theobjects: databases or tables to becopied, • the renaming rules to thecopy objects, • whether the indexesare to be copied, • whether the relatedRUNSTATS should be transferred tothe target system catalog, • whetherother related objects (GRANTS,BINDS, VIEWS) should also be transferred,• whether the source objects should be put in"read only" mode during the copy, • whether <strong>BCV5</strong> shouldbe used to avoid impacting the source objects. Once atask is defi ned it may be executed at any time under<strong>BCV5</strong>’s control or under the shop’s scheduler or manuallyon a stage by stage basis.User creates a copy task using ISPF or Workstation or Batch InterfaceSource DB2Extract meta data from DB2 CatalogSet objects ’read only’ optionoptionallyCopy Pagesets or Imagecopies<strong>BCV5</strong> – Task Definition and ExecutionTarget DB2Check, amend,add DDLMake objects readyand execute objects<strong>BCV5</strong> Workflow3 | 5 © UBS Hainer distributed in the US and Canada by ESAi - <strong>Enterprise</strong> <strong>Systems</strong> <strong>Associates</strong>, <strong>Inc</strong>.Contact ESAI Contact at: 1-866-464-3724 ESAi at 1-866-GO-4-ESAi or sales@ESAIGroup.comor


<strong>BCV5</strong> – FAST AND EFFICIENT DB2 DATA MIGRATIONS» With <strong>BCV5</strong> we have been able toreduce our batch processing cycleby 2 1/2 hours and are meeting ourSLA commitment for the reportingdatabase for the first time ever. «Optional ComponentsBCV6 – Consistent copying without impacting dataavailability. When data must come from tables thatrequire 24x7 enterprise availability there is an issue forIT. Users need to query and update the tables withoutinterruption. Stopping the source objects is not a viableoption. Without stopping the source objects, it can bevery diffi cult to copy tables while preserving consistencybetween tables and indexes and between different tables.<strong>BCV5</strong> minimizes the copy time, but cannot avoid theimpact of changes made to objects while they are beingcopied. The good news is that DB2 stores informationabout all these table changes in its log. <strong>BCV5</strong> is anautomated solution that uses the information in the logto bring the copied tablespace to a consistent state.Data Replication – Copy only a subset of your data.Why copy an entire table when a smaller and moremanageable subset will get the job done? Depending onthe test plan a full table copy may not be necessary. Ifa particular test scenario only requires customers froma certain zip code, for example, why copy an entiretable with thousands or millions of unwanted rows? Astables grow in size there is not always enough free spaceto hold multiple copies of test data. At times it is preferableto specify copy criteria for skipping rows prior to copyingor replicating them.required. Replacing the name and other sensitive informationwith random data is a typical requirement. Often itis essential to replace fi elds according to specifi c patternsso that the original data relationships can be maintainedfor parallel and integration testing.Archive Data – Archive DB2 data once and populatedifferent environments. Need to provide DB2 data fromlast week, last month or last year? Want an automatic andeffi cient procedure to recreate everything, DDL and datain record time? <strong>BCV5</strong> Icebox (IB) takes fast snapshots ondemand or periodically, and restores the objects or databaseswhere/when needed using names specifi ed. Issuesof compatibility or completeness no longer cause concern.IB packages the DB2 Version x imagecopy and later restoresit to any other DB2 target version required. Upgradeto a newer version of DB2 knowing that former imagecopies will be still available for future needs.Data Management – Mask sensitive DB2 data at thesource. Organizations normally need to copy sensitive datafrom a production system to a testing or QA environment.In order to adhere to data privacy regulations and corporatesecurity, a signifi cant amount of extra processing is often4 | 5 © UBS Hainer distributed in the US and Canada by ESAi - <strong>Enterprise</strong> <strong>Systems</strong> <strong>Associates</strong>, <strong>Inc</strong>.Contact ESAI Contact at: 1-866-464-3724 ESAi at 1-866-GO-4-ESAi or sales@ESAIGroup.comor


<strong>BCV5</strong> – FAST AND EFFICIENT DB2 DATA MIGRATIONSThe DB2 High-End Product Line:BCV4 Full DB2 Subsystem Clones in minutes versus days<strong>BCV5</strong> Save 90% CPU & Run Time with each DB2 copyBCV6 Log enhanced copies for 24x7 DB2 refresh/migrationBPA4DB2 Premier advisor for DB2 buffer pool optimizationULT4DB2 Easily identify & restore unwanted changes of DB2 dataTUC4DB2 RTS & Policy driven automation of DB2 data maintenance» The copy speed of <strong>BCV5</strong> is veryimpressive, it rivals hardwareassisted copy mechanisms. «XM4DB2 Pro-active surveillance for a greater DB2 availability––––––––––––––––––––––––––––––––––––––––––––––––––––––––––Contact Us For More InformationWe offer a free 30-day trial evaluation as well as private webdemo. Learn more about <strong>BCV5</strong> and our complete line ofDB2 z/OS products at: www.ubs-hainer.comDISTRIBUTED IN THE US & CANADA BYTel.: 1-866-GO-4-ESAisales@ESAIGroup.comwww.ESAIGroup.com5 | 5 © UBS Hainer distributed in the US and Canada by ESAi - <strong>Enterprise</strong> <strong>Systems</strong> <strong>Associates</strong>, <strong>Inc</strong>.

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!